SUV Heading To PM Modi's Chhattisgarh Event Falls Off Bridge, Two Killed

Two people were killed and seven others injured after an SUV heading to PM Narendra Modi's function in Chhattisgarh's Bilaspur fell off a bridge and plunged into a river in the Gaurela-Pendra-Marwahi district on Sunday.

The vehicle with eight persons onboard was heading to Bilaspur from the Manendragarh-Chirmiri-Bharatpur (MCB) district when its driver lost control of the wheel over the Son River. The SUV hit a woman pedestrian before plunging into the river. The woman pedestrian and the driver died on the spot, while seven other occupants of the SUV sustained injuries, an official said.

The injured were admitted to the Gaurela district hospital, where five were in critical condition.

PM Modi In Chhattisgarh

Prime Minister Modi will lay the foundation stone, initiate commencement of work and dedicate multiple development projects worth more than Rs 33,700 crore in Mohbhattha village of Bilaspur district in the afternoon.

PM Modi will also lay the foundation for various projects, initiate the commencement of works, and address a public meeting during his first visit to the state after the 2024 Lok Sabha elections.

Around 2 lakh people are expected to attend the function, officials said, adding that security has been heightened in the area.

PM Modi will reach Bilaspur at around 3:30 pm and will also address a public meeting, an official statement said.

The dedication of projects, laying of foundation stones, and commencement of work will be conducted virtually by Modi from Mohbhatta village.

In line with the prime minister’s commitment to improving the power sector in India, multiple steps will be undertaken in providing affordable and reliable power and making Chhattisgarh self-reliant in power generation, it said.

Earlier today, the prime minister visited Deekshabhoomi in Nagpur, the place where Dr Bhimrao Ambedkar and his followers embraced Buddhism. He offered prayers to Gautam Buddha at the site.

Accompanied by Maharashtra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is and Union Minister Nitin Gadkari, Modi reached Deekshabhoomi after paying tributes to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h (RSS) founders at the Dr Hedgewar Smruti Mandir in the city.
